D 2C exercise start-up Boldfit onboards cricketer KL Rahul as capitalist targets Rs five hundred crore earnings by FY26, ET Retail

.New Delhi: Boldfit, a direct-to-consumer (D2C) exercise brand has onboarded Indian cricketer KL Rahul as a label ambassador and an entrepreneur in the firm, it showed ETRetail.Without divulging the exact percent of risk the cricketer has actually taken, the firm mentioned it is actually a sizable as well as key investment.This collaboration strives to utilize KL's immense level of popularity, especially one of young people and also health and fitness aficionados, to expand Boldfit's dip untapped markets and demographics all over India.Sharing regarding the company's development plannings, Pallav Bihani, founder and chief executive officer of the business mentioned, "Our team are actually going all-in on broadening our activewear and also shoes groups, which are actually readied to redefine the health and fitness market. These portions are our potential growth motors." Presently, physical fitness and yoga exercise devices drive most of Boldfit's purchases, Bihani shared.In the 2022-23, the D2C company attained an income of Rs 73 crore. Along with calculated projects and this collaboration, the label strives to reach a revenue of Rs five hundred crore by FY26. Founded in 2018, it currently serves over 1 crore consumers every year and also targets to expand this range to 5 crore using this collaboration. Also, it is boosting its source establishment framework to make sure rapid distribution as well as constant product availability.Looking onward, the D2C start-up anticipates an eruption in online visitor traffic, social networking sites interaction, as well as much higher sales all over our flagship categories.
